Shirva: Woman, young man killed in ghastly road accident


Team Udayavani, Dec 24, 2022, 6:52 PM IST

Shirva: Two occupants of a car died in a ghastly road accident when the vehicle collided head-on with an oncoming tempo near Panjimaru Palame on Katapady-Shirva main road here on Saturday, December 24.

The deceased included a woman and a young man. Their identities could not be immediately ascertained. The car’s occupants are believed to be from Bengaluru. Pawan B. S (27) was found printed on a driver’s license found at the accident scene.

The car was moving towards Shirva from Katapady when it collided head-on with a tempo coming from the opposite direction. As a result of the impact, the woman died on the spot. The youth who was seriously injured was rushed to the Government hospital in Udupi where he was declared dead.

The incident took place under Shirwa police station limits. Thepolice officials reached the spot and are conducting an inspection.
